Choosing The Right System For Your Home

Selecting an HVAC system involves assessing comfort needs, energy efficiency goals, and budget. Important considerations include:

  • System Type (central air, ductless mini-splits, heat pumps) based on home layout and existing infrastructure.
  • Efficiency Ratings such as SEER for air conditioners and HSPF for heat pumps, which influence long-term operating costs.
  • Sizing proper tonnage and airflow to prevent short cycling and ensure even cooling/heating.
  • Warranty And Reliability tied to the chosen brand and installation quality.

Professional assessments typically involve load calculations (manual J), duct inspections, and refrigerant charge checks to tailor a system that aligns with climate patterns and energy usage expectations.

Maintenance And Longevity

Regular maintenance extends equipment life and preserves efficiency. Typical maintenance tasks include:

  • Seasonal Tune-Ups for comfort system readiness before peak usage.
  • Filter Replacements and air quality checks to maintain indoor air quality.
  • Thermostat calibrations ensuring accurate temperature readings and schedules.
  • System Cleaning of condensate drains, coils, and burners as applicable.

Homeowners should inquire about maintenance plans, preferred filter types, and recommended service intervals to maximize performance and prevent costly repairs.
